Physically, Ruthenium(III) Chloride typically appears as a black powder or crystalline solid. It possesses a high melting point, often decomposing above 500°C, and a density of approximately 3.11 g/mL. Its solubility is limited in water and ethanol but it readily dissolves in hydrochloric acid, which is often leveraged during its use in synthesis. The primary application of Ruthenium(III) Chloride lies in its role as a catalyst. It is widely employed in various organic reactions, including hydrogenation, oxidation, and cross-coupling reactions. Its ability to participate in redox cycles makes it exceptionally effective in facilitating chemical transformations that are vital for the production of fine chemicals, pharmaceuticals, and advanced materials. Beyond catalysis, Ruthenium(III) Chloride serves as a precursor for synthesizing other ruthenium-based compounds and nanomaterials. These derived materials find applications in fields such as electronics, where they are used in thin-film deposition for conductive layers, and in renewable energy, notably as sensitizers in dye-sensitized solar cells (DSSCs).
